European Retail Partnership Specialist
1 week ago
About the Job
We are seeking an European Retail Partnership Specialist to join our team in Copenhagen, Denmark. In this role, you will be responsible for developing and implementing strategic partnerships with key retailers in Denmark, Sweden, Norway, and Finland.
Key Responsibilities
- Customer Facing: Build strong relationships with key decision-makers and drive business growth.
- Product Forecasting and Replenishment: Collaborate with customers to optimize forecasting and replenishment processes.
- Strategy: Develop and implement strategies to increase revenue and profit goals.
- Trade Marketing & Activity Planning: Plan and execute marketing activities and promotions to meet customer needs.
- Data Analysis and Reporting: Analyze data to inform business decisions and optimize processes.
- Financial: Manage budgets and track spending to meet financial targets.
- Management and Leadership: Lead by example and mentor junior team members.
About You
- University degree in Economics or Business Administration.
- At least 4 years of experience in sales, with 2+ years managing key accounts.
- Selling and negotiation skills in an international environment.
- Fluent English, other Scandinavian languages considered a plus.
